Write project images to a user-specified location.
Takes an imageList and writes it's images to disk at a user-specified location. This works both with and without context (context menus and file menu).
internalData() stores: ImageList name [OPTIONAL] - need context if this isn't present (see WorkOrder::imageList()) Output directory name [REQUIRED]

This method is designed to be implemented by children work orders.
The order of execution for undo is: syncUndo() - GUI thread asyncUndo() - Pooled thread* postSyncUndo() - GUI thread
State can be read from the parent WorkOrder class and from state set in syncUndo() while in this method. You can set state to be used in postSyncUndo() safely. Please be wary of deleting QObjects inside of this method because they will cause unpredictable crashes. This method is never executed in the GUI thread. You can update progress by calling setProgressRange() and setProgressValue(). Please do not manipulate any GUI objects here.

This method is designed to be implemented by children work orders.
The order of execution for redo is: syncRedo() - GUI thread* asyncRedo() - Pooled thread postSyncRedo() - GUI thread
State should only be read from the parent WorkOrder class in this method. You can set state to be used in asyncRedo() and postSyncRedo() safely. This method is always executed in the GUI thread and has no progress.
